Engineering Design Of Jingyu Qinglong River Reservoir In Jilin Province

With the increase of capital investment in water conservancy projects,reservoir design becomes one of the important tasks of water conservancy construction,which plays an important role in solving local water supply and social economy.Jilin Province Jingyu County forecast2020 years,2030 total water demand of 11.62 million m3,17.71 million m3,the status of water supply capacity is insufficient;According to the Engineering geology analysis,the bedrock of Dam Foundation has seepage,subsidence and sliding stability,and the left abutment has the problem of seepage and sliding stability,There is a problem of seepage around dam abutment.In view of the above situation,this paper has completed the design of Qinglong River Reservoir through analysis,calculation and evaluation.This paper mainly carried out the following research.According to the current situation of water supply in Jingyu County urban area,water consumption survey,the analysis of the quota,carried out the water demand forecast,analysis of the reservoir water content to meet the needs of the city water;According to the present condition of the reservoir,the utilization degree of water supply,water structure and water resources development,the potential of reservoir water resources development is analyzed.Combined with engineering geology description to evaluate the geological condition of the project area;According to the basic hydrological and meteorological data,the relationship between runoff,flood,staged flood and water level flow is established,according to the design level year and the design guarantee rate,the reservoir's hing-profit regulation,the flood regulation and the engineering influence are analyzed.According to the Engineering geology description and the plan result and design water supply The overall layout plan of the reservoir,the selection of the dam type,the discharge structure and the pipe diameter of the pipe are proposed,and the environmental protection measures are put forward according to the possible environmental problems after completion of the project.Through the above research,the total water demand of Jingyu County city in 2020 years and 2030 is 11.62 million m~3 and 17.71 million m~3 respectively,and the reservoir can improve the potential of the exploitation.The Engineering geology analysis shows that although there are some seepage,submergence and immersion problems in the reservoir area,the collapse of the two reservoirs is limited,which has little effect on the normal operation of the reservoir,and the location layer of the building base surface of the hydraulic structure can meet the requirement of bearing capacity.The annual runoff 1.54m~3/s of the reservoir Dam site,the total storage capacity of the Qinglong River Reservoir 1002x104m~3,the 635x104m~3,the dead water level is 590.0m,the dead capacity is 149x104m~3,the normal storing position is 601m,the corresponding capacity is 785x104m~3,Reservoir design flood stage 602.92m,check the flood stage 603.56m,the reservoir design year water supply is 1510x104m~3,the annual average water supply quantity is1464x104m~3.Engineering Design selected Dam site for the Shangba line,that is,Tsing Lung River and the Lake River at the confluence of about 400m downstream,Gravity Dam crest elevation 603.63m,stability,stress,leakage calculation to meet the design requirements.
